Optimality conditions and duality for E-differentiable multiobjective programming involving V-E-type I functions
Najeeb Abdulaleem, Savin Treanţă
Abstract
Abstract In this paper, we introduce a new concept of sets and a new class of functions called $$\alpha$$ <mml:math xmlns:mml="http://www.w3.org/1998/Math/MathML"> <mml:mi>α</mml:mi> </mml:math> - E -invex sets and V-E-preinvex functions. Furthermore, a new concept of generalized convexity is introduced for (not necessarily) differentiable vector optimization problems. Namely, the concept of V - E -type I functions is defined for E -differentiable vector optimization problem. A number of sufficiency results are established under various types of (generalized) V - E -type I requirements. Moreover, several E -duality theorems in the sense of Mond–Weir are proved under appropriate (generalized) V - E -type I functions.
